Students worked in groups of 3 to design a Truss bridge, with Specific measurement parameters for the length, width, height, and weight of the bridge. The students were only allowed to use spaghetti and white glue to build their bridges. The groups spent 6 days building and rebuilding parts of their bridges. On the last days we measured each Bridge and those that stayed within the parameters were tested for failure. We put baking soda boxes on the bridges until they broke -students loved that part!. Students spent some time reflecting on their structure compared to other groups’ bridges and what they would change or modify for next time.

Bridges is one of the Science Olympiad Events that will be available to compete in this January for Middle School students.

These are the students' practice design and building activity.
